IVI organized Change the Game: workshop on Sports
Vision at the NSHM Knowledge campus in Kolkata on 25-26 September and Dr.
Shroff’s Charity Eye Hospital, Delhi on 28-29 September 2014.
Training in Sports vision improves the visual
abilities of sportsmen required for securing excellence in the sport they play,
including eye-hand coordination, dynamic visual acuity, tracking, focusing,
visual reaction time, and peripheral vision. The workshop emphasized on the
importance of visual performance assessment designed to meet the requirements
of each sports and how optometrists can play an important role in improving the
visual capabilities of sports personnel.

The workshop was facilitated by Professor Graham
Barclay Erickson, a Diplomat in the Binocular Vision and Paediatric Optometry
Section of the American Academy of Optometry, Fellow of COVD, and Professor at
Pacific University College of Optometry.
